课堂 需求 案例 软件

什么是软件的 Legal Disclosure?

软件的 Legal disclosure 指的是软件开发者或发布者为了合法合规地向用户提供软件服务而提供的法律声明和公告。这些声明通常包括软件的版权信息、许可证信息、使用条款和隐私政策等内容。 版权信息声明通常包括软件的作者和所有者,以及软件的版权说明和保留条款。许可证信息则涉及到软件的授权和使用方 ......
Disclosure Legal 软件

什么是软件开发领域的 disruptive innovation

“Disruptive innovation”(颠覆性创新)是由哈佛商学院教授克莱顿·克里斯坦森提出的概念,指的是一种新技术、新产品或新服务,能够彻底颠覆传统市场和商业模式,重新定义行业格局和规则。 通常情况下,这种创新并非针对已有的市场和客户需求,而是面向未开发或不满足市场需求的新领域。创新者通常 ......

什么是软件开发领域的 obsolete 或者 deprecated 含义

我们在学习一门编程语言或者说使用一些工具 API 时,经常会看到文档或者 API 参数说明里,标注了 obsolete,deprecated,deprecation 等字眼。 这些单词代表什么含义呢? obsolete 特性 在软件设计领域,obsolete 特性代表着某些功能或API已经被废弃或不 ......

什么是软件开发领域的 roll-forward 发布策略

使用 roll-forward 方法,意味着只有最新版本的库才会获得错误修复和新功能。 软件开发和发布领域的 roll-forward 方法是一种基于版本控制的策略,其中只有最新版本的软件库或组件会被支持、更新和维护,旧版本则不再得到官方支持。这意味着在软件库或组件的更新过程中,只有最新版本才能获得 ......

C++恶意软件开发(五)Linux shellcoding

什么是shellcode? Shellcode通常指的是一段用于攻击的机器码(二进制代码),可以被注入到目标计算机中并在其中执行。Shellcode 的目的是利用目标系统的漏洞或弱点,以获取系统控制权或执行恶意操作。它的名称来自于它经常被注入到攻击者编写的恶意软件的 shell 环境中,以便让攻击者 ......
shellcoding 软件开发 恶意 Linux 软件

入门案例认证流程图讲解、思路分析

入门案例认证流程图讲解 概念速查: Authenticcation接口:它的实现类,表示当前访问系统的用户,封装了用户相关信息。 AuthenticcationManager接口:定义了认证Authenticcation的方法 UserDetailsService接口:加载用户特定数据的核心接口。里 ......
流程图 思路 流程 案例

软件中GA、Release、RC、Beta、Alpha 各版本号的意义

1、GA:(general availability) General Availability,正式发布的版本,国外通常用 GA 来标识 release 版本,GA 版本是开发团队认为该版本是稳定版(有的软件可能会标识为 Stable 版本或者 Production 版本,其意思和 GA 相同), ......
意义 Release 版本 Alpha 软件

领域驱动设计-软件核心复杂性应对之道:第三章

三、绑定模型和实现 模型种类繁多,目的各有不同,即使是那些仅用于软件开发项目的模型也是如此。领域驱动设计要求模型不仅能够指导早期的分析工作,还应该成为设计的基础。这种设计方法对于代码的编写有着重要的暗示作用。不太明显的一点就是:领域驱动设计要求一种不同的建模方法..... 3.1 模式:model- ......
复杂性 核心 领域 第三章 软件

SpringSecurity入门案例准备工作、入门案例引入SpringSecurity

SpringSecurity入门案例准备工作 1.快速入门 1.1准备工作 我们先要搭建一个简单的SpringBoot工程 1、设置父工程 添加依赖 <parent> <groupId>org.springframework.boot</groupId> <artifactId>spring-boo ......
SpringSecurity 案例

ubuntu切换软件源为国内源

Ubuntu安装完毕之后,默认的源是Ubuntu自己的,但毕竟Ubuntu服务器在国外,我们访问起来会比较慢,可以将软件源切换为国内源,比如:阿里源,清华源,中科大源等等。在这边以清华源为例,其它源也是一样的道理。 切换源之前先把配置文件备份一份 sudo cp /etc/apt/sources.l ......
ubuntu 软件

学生管理系统的需求文档

学生管理系统 需求: ​ 采取控制台的方式去书写学生管理系统。 分析: 初始菜单: " " "1.添加学生" "2.删除学生" "3.修改学生" "4.查询学生" "5.退出" "请输入您的选择:" 学生类 ​ 属性:id、姓名、年龄、家庭住址 添加功能: ​ 键盘录入每一个学生信息并添加,需要满足 ......
管理系统 需求 文档 学生 系统

未来课堂学习机平板刷机教程

前言: 同事的朋友有个未来课堂的平板,让我帮忙刷机想要能正常使用,现在一打开主界面只有未来课堂的软件界面无法退出,在网上没有找到很好的教程,琢磨一下其实也很简单现在分享给大家希望有用 1 找平板固件包 (当然也可以在刷机软件中找固件包) (1)我手里的平板是台电的很好找去官网就能找到如下图,先点击软 ......
学习机 平板 课堂 教程

SQL优化改写案例12(DM数据库SQL优化)

京华开发一哥们找我优化条SQL,反馈在DM数据库执行时间很慢需要 40s 才能出结果,安排。 原SQL: SELECT A.IND_CODE, A.IND_NAME AS "specialName", COUNT(C.ORDER_ID) AS "orderCount", COUNT(CASE WHE ......
SQL 案例 数据库 数据

软件工程日报——《用户故事与迅捷方法》读书笔记一

《用户故事与迅捷方法》(User Stories Applied: For Agile Software Development)是一本介绍敏捷软件开发中用户故事的书籍。下面是我的读书笔记: 作者Mike Cohn从如何编写用户故事开始,逐步给读者讲解了使用用户故事做敏捷开发的过程、如何划分优先级以 ......
软件工程 笔记 日报 方法 故事

软件工程日报——每日站立会议4

昨天:我继续进行排班代码的编写 今天:写排班代码思路混乱,今天开始整合一下我们组的成果,进行整体框架的修改完善 遇到的问题:由于每个人的编程习惯不同,整合代码资源需要点时间,完善页面信息进行调版 ......
软件工程 会议 日报 工程 软件

软件工程日报——每日站立会议

补一天的每日站立会议,昨天忘记了时间,没有发,今天发出来 前天:我否定了昨天的思路,创建了一个新的排班数据库 对于每个员工,根据排班规则生成一周内的所有可用班次。例如,如果员工可以在周一上班,则生成一条记录,包括员工ID、班次开始时间、结束时间、所在门店等信息。 昨天:我继续进行排班代码的编写 ......
软件工程 会议 日报 工程 软件

软件体系架构质量属性-性能

摘要:随着软件系统规模和复杂度的不断增加,软件性能已成为软件体系架构中至关重要的一个质量属性。性能问题会直接影响用户体验、系统稳定性和可靠性等方面,因此,如何确保软件体系架构在设计和实现过程中具备良好的性能特征,已成为软件开发过程中的一个重要问题。本文主要介绍了软件体系架构中的性能问题,探讨了如何在 ......
架构 属性 性能 体系 质量

GoodSync(最好的文件同步软件)

GoodSync是一款使用创新的最好的文件同步软件,可以在你的台式机、笔记本、USB外置驱动器等设备直接进行数据文件同步软件。 GoodSync将高度稳定的可靠性和极其简单的易用性完美结合起来,可以实现两台电脑、电脑与云端网盘、电脑和远程FTP服务器、电脑与U盘之间的数据和文件的同步转换。 Good ......
GoodSync 文件 最好 软件

如何构建适合自己的DevOps软件测试改进方案

​根据2022年的DevOps全球调查报告显示,主流软件企业采用或部分采用DevOps且已获得良好成效的占比已达70%,DevOps俨然成为当下软件开发研究的重要方向。 测试作为软件开发的必要过程,是提升软件可靠性、保证软件质量的关键环节。然而,从过往研究文献来看,希望通过DevOps提升软件交付效 ......
软件测试 方案 DevOps 软件

CSS 基础拾遗(核心知识、常见需求)

本篇文章围绕了 CSS 的核心知识点和项目中常见的需求来展开。虽然行文偏长,但较基础,适合初级中级前端阅读,阅读的时候请适当跳过已经掌握的部分。 这篇文章断断续续写了比较久,也参考了许多优秀的文章,但或许文章里还是存在不好或不对的地方,请多多指教,可以评论里直接提出来哈。 核心概念和知识点 语法 C ......
核心 常见 需求 基础 知识

远程办公软件哪个好?远程办公软件推荐

远程办公软件哪个好? 自从yq爆发以来,远程办公成为了人们生活中不可或缺的一部分。随着yq的加剧,越来越多的公司开始尝试远程办公。为此,远程办公软件的需求也急剧上升。但是,远程办公软件市场如此广泛和复杂,它们中的许多都有类似的功能和服务。那么,远程办公软件哪个好呢?本文将介绍一些值得注意的特点和推荐 ......
办公软件 软件

推荐一些好用软件吧

音乐播放器 洛雪音乐 一个开源的音乐播放器,全平台支持。且不用登陆,也不用会员 https://github.com/lyswhut 茂茂音乐播放器 一个96年的小朋友做的开源的音乐播放平添,不过都是网页版本的。 如果你的设备低配,或者不想安装客户端,不妨一试。 https://github.com ......
软件

远程控制软件有哪些,实名避坑推荐

远程控制软件是一种技术工具,允许用户通过互联网远程控制他人的计算机。该软件通常用于公司或个人远程管理其他计算机的功能。它们允许用户远程操作他人电脑上的程序、文件或网页,或查看目标计算机的屏幕图片和其他信息。因此,该软件也广泛应用于技术支持、远程办公和远程合作。在这里,我们将介绍一些常见的远程控制软件 ......
远程控制 实名 软件

记一次从JS到内网的横向案例

前言前段时间参加了一场攻防演练,使用常规漏洞尝试未果后,想到不少师傅分享过从JS中寻找突破的文章,于是硬着头皮刚起了JS,最终打开了内网入口获取了靶标权限和个人信息。在此分享一下过程。声明:本次演练中,所有测试设备均由主办方提供,所有流量均有留档可审计,所有操作均在授权下完成,所有数据在结束后均已安 ......
横向 案例

“露天煤矿现场调研和交流案例分享”在CSDN发表,两次审核未通过,判定:全篇涉及广告

我在博客园发布了:露天煤矿现场调研和交流案例分享。后台分享到了CSDN,结果判定为:全篇涉及广告。我要是真能写出来全篇涉及广告的文章,也算我能力比较强,就算是让ChatGPT可能也写不出来吧。 这种坐在办公室的小白人员来审核,简直也是无语了。 也不知道是不是CSDN内容泛滥,现在确实有改邪归正的想法 ......
全篇 露天 煤矿 案例 广告

某毕业设计里面的特殊需求记录,给卖家评分后,给卖家加分,给邀请自己的人加一半的分,给自己加分

@RequestMapping(value = "/updateUserScore", method = RequestMethod.POST) @ResponseBody public DataResponse updateUserScore(@RequestBody Product item, ......
卖家 毕业设计 需求

打好软件国产化攻坚战,闪信科技面向人工智能和数字经济进行新一代升级

数字经济浪潮席卷全球,面对日益激烈的市场竞争和残酷的技术封锁,国产化行至中场,国产化已经成为我国IT基础产业中长期发展的确定性趋势。 长期以来,闪信科技深耕政企服务领域,积累了丰富的政府、公安、央企国企数字化服务经验,一直以来采用自主创新的信息技术,打造政企管理转型升级的解决方案。目前,闪信科技主动 ......

远程控制电脑的软件哪个比较好用

有多种软件选项可用于远程控制计算机,最适合您的软件选项取决于您的具体需要和要求。 以下是一些最流行的远程控制软件选项及其功能和优势: TeamViewer TeamViewer 是使用最广泛的远程控制软件选项之一。 它具有用户友好的界面,并提供文件传输、会话记录和远程打印等功能。 TeamViewe ......
远程控制 电脑 软件

软件测试常用术语

软件测试:Software Testing 黑盒测试:Black-box Testing 白盒测试:White-box Testing 手工测试:Manual Testing 自动化测试:Automated Testing 单元测试:Component Testing/Unit Testing 集成 ......
软件测试 术语 常用 软件

量子计算案例

使用量子计算机 量子计算机擅长解决量子问题,例如寻找分子的结构。分子是由电子组成的,而电子是量子力学的。了解它们对于开发新药物和材料(例如太阳能)至关重要。然而,理解分子及其相互作用很困难,因为它们呈现出量子问题,而传统计算机不擅长处理这些问题。为了使用现代的经典计算机,需要将分子这个量子问题分成许 ......
量子 案例